1. What is Social Interaction? 

A social interaction is an exchange between two or more individuals and is a building block
of society. Social interaction can be studied between groups of two (dyads), three (triads) or
larger social groups. 

2. What is Social Relationship? 

Social relation or social interaction is any relationship between two or more individual social
relation derived from individual agency form the basis of social structure and basic object for
analysis by social scientist around us.

1. What is collective behavior? 

Collective refers to ways of thinking, feeling and acting which develop among a large number
of people and which are relatively spontaneous and unstructured.

2. What is disaster? 

A disaster is tragedy of a natural or human made hazard that negatively affects the society or
environment. Disaster is any sudden event caused by nature or man.

1. What is responsible parenthood? 

It is the ability of a parent to detect the need, happiness and desire of the children and helping
them to become responsible and reasonable children. It is the ability of parent to meet and
cater for the needs of the family and children according to his or her capability.

2. What is family planning? 

Family Planning is the process by which responsible and mature couples, if they wish,
determine by themselves the timing and number of children born to them.
